Why Examination of Specific Game Mechanics Matters

Deep dives into the nuances of game mechanics—like the payline structures, RTP (Return to Player) percentages, and volatility—are essential for designing or selecting games that maximise engagement. For example, slot games with medium volatility balance risk and reward, appealing to a broad spectrum of players. Recognising these patterns informs better decision-making for both players and operators.

Visualising Data: The Impact of RTP and Volatility

Feature Description Impact on Player Experience
RTP (Return to Player) Percentage of wagered money that the game pays back over time Higher RTP (e.g., 96%) tends to appeal to risk-averse players seeking consistent returns
Volatility Frequency and size of payouts Medium volatility games offer a balanced experience, suitable for long-term engagement
Bonus Features Special rounds like free spins, multipliers, jackpots Keep players engaged by rewarding them periodically, increasing session duration
